Description
The Cooperative State University Baden-Württemberg offers the six-semester degree program “Bachelor of Engineering in Wood Technology”. It provides in-depth knowledge of the engineering and business management. Students can choose between three areas to specialize in: Furniture and Interior Construction, Construction Elements and Timber Construction, Field of Study Wood and Plastics Technology. In addition to their seminars and theoretical lectures such as Mathematics, Technical Physics, Technical Chemistry, and Design Engineering, students can take part in an internship program, where they will gain essential professional knowledge and will improve their personal, social and business skills. Upon successful completion of the course, graduates will be qualified for career as an engineer in the field of production and plant management, department management in design and development, application technology and many more.
